Trade Desk shares plunge on weak revenue, guidance miss

Trade Desk Inc (NASDAQ:TTD) shares tumbled almost 30% in premarket trading on Friday after the digital advertising technology company reported second-quarter revenue and profit that missed Wall Street estimates and issued a third-quarter forecast far below expectations.

The company posted revenue of $715 million for the quarter, up 3% year-over-year but short of analysts' estimate of $751 million. Adjusted earnings per share came in at $0.34, down 17% from a year earlier and below the $0.40 expected.

Adjusted EBITDA was $241 million, compared with estimates of $261 million, while adjusted net income totaled $158 million versus expectations of $187 million.

For the third quarter, Trade Desk guided revenue of at least $650 million, well short of the $805 million analysts had forecast. The company also guided EBITDA of approximately $160 million, compared with estimates of $341 million.

"This quarter did not meet the standard we set for ourselves," Trade Desk CEO Jeff Green told shareholders.

Other second-quarter metrics included a net income margin of 9%, down 400 basis points year-over-year, and an EBITDA margin of 34%, down 500 basis points. Customer retention remained above 95%. The company repurchased $78 million in shares during the quarter.

Analysts at Jefferies said the company's margin structure is breaking down as Trade Desk continues to invest in Kokai upgrades, measurement and other initiatives, and said it was skeptical of the returns from that spending.

Jefferies lowered its fiscal 2027 EBITDA margin estimate to 29% from 40%.

“With (revenue) in decline, margins rebasing lower, and structural concerns unresolved, it's difficult to envision a turnaround,” the analysts wrote.
